Idiopathic Pulmonary Fibrosis is a concise, clinically focused guide designed specifically for practicing clinicians who care for patients with this progressive and often fatal lung disease. Authored by leading experts Drs. Kevin K. Brown and Jeff Swigris, this practical resource offers a clear and digestible overview of the epidemiology, genetics, biomarkers, pathology, diagnosis, monitoring, and treatment of idiopathic pulmonary fibrosis (IPF). With an emphasis on improving both patient outcomes and quality of life, the book serves as a valuable tool for physicians navigating the complexities of IPF in everyday clinical practice.
